## Environments — Spokewise Rebalancer

Spokewise computes nightly dock-to-dock transfer plans for the Verlton bike-share network. We run three environments: dev (synthetic trip data), staging (a week-old snapshot of Verlton's dock telemetry), and prod. Staging is the only environment where the solver's time limit differs from prod, so benchmark comparisons must account for that. When reviewing changes to the planner, verify behavior against staging first. The current staging configuration values, as deployed this sprint, are listed below.

service settings:
[casax]
port = 6379
team = rusir
host = casax.zemvarhq.corp
region = outer-4
access_code = ac_9808ce
timeout_ms = 1500

Checklist item 7 — Off-site run to Pellam Crag station

Spare parts crate: two filter housings, gasket set, Vintor relay pack. Verify against the site request slip. Seal crate, tag orange. Load last, unload first. Driver confirms contents with the station keeper on arrival. Courier hand-over must follow the confidential instruction below.

dispatch memo: the lamwyn fenwyn courier leaves the wenir ledger at gate 7175 under passcode 822969

Handover note — idempotency keys, Paylark retries

Welcome aboard. The Paylark gateway derives idempotency keys from order ID plus attempt window; never regenerate them on retry, or Briarbank's processor will double-charge. Key derivation secrets live in the Coldhollow vault, rotated quarterly. If the vault is sealed when you need to rotate, use the recovery flow. The vault recovery passphrase follows below.

strongbox words: pelok-istax-norir-quenius-keleth-quenys